Showing
1 changed file
with
4 additions
and
0 deletions
xingyun-sc/src/main/java/com/lframework/xingyun/sc/impl/shipments/ShipmentsOrderInfoServiceImpl.java
| @@ -266,6 +266,10 @@ public class ShipmentsOrderInfoServiceImpl extends BaseMpServiceImpl<ShipmentsOr | @@ -266,6 +266,10 @@ public class ShipmentsOrderInfoServiceImpl extends BaseMpServiceImpl<ShipmentsOr | ||
| 266 | List<PurchaseOrderInfo> purchaseOrderInfos = purchaseOrderInfoService.listByIds(orderIds); | 266 | List<PurchaseOrderInfo> purchaseOrderInfos = purchaseOrderInfoService.listByIds(orderIds); |
| 267 | List<WarrantyCertificateVo> warrantyCertificateList = new ArrayList<>(); | 267 | List<WarrantyCertificateVo> warrantyCertificateList = new ArrayList<>(); |
| 268 | for (PurchaseOrderInfo info : purchaseOrderInfos) { | 268 | for (PurchaseOrderInfo info : purchaseOrderInfos) { |
| 269 | + if (StringUtils.isEmpty(info.getWarrantyCertificateFileId()) | ||
| 270 | + || StringUtils.isEmpty(info.getWarrantyCertificateFileName())) { | ||
| 271 | + continue; | ||
| 272 | + } | ||
| 269 | WarrantyCertificateVo vo = new WarrantyCertificateVo(); | 273 | WarrantyCertificateVo vo = new WarrantyCertificateVo(); |
| 270 | vo.setFileId(info.getWarrantyCertificateFileId()); | 274 | vo.setFileId(info.getWarrantyCertificateFileId()); |
| 271 | vo.setFileName(info.getWarrantyCertificateFileName()); | 275 | vo.setFileName(info.getWarrantyCertificateFileName()); |